> This ticket adds the ability for operators to disallow use of ALLOW FILTERING 
> predicates in CQL SELECT statements. As queries that ALLOW FILTERING can 
> place additional load on the database, the flag enables operators to provide 
> tighter bounds on performance guarantees. The patch includes a new yaml 
> property, as well as a hot property enabling the value to be modified via JMX 
> at runtime.
